From 1 January 2024, eligible children will receive up to 15 hours of free kindergarten per week at our Centre, up to 600 hours per year. This fee support is on top of any Child Care Subsidy eligible families may be receiving.

To take advantage of this additional support children must be at least four years of age by 30 June in the year before they attend Primary School and be enrolled at an approved program for at least 2 days a week. Ask us for more information when you visit our Centre.

Good to Know - What to Bring

What we Provide

  • Nappies and wipes
  • Bed linen
  • Guardian hat
  • SPF 50+ sunscreen
  • All nutritious meals and snacks

What to Bring

  • Water bottle
  • Spare change of clothing, labelled
  • Soft toy or comfort blanket for nap time
  • Baby's bottles for formula or breastmilk

For children aged three and four years, we provide high-quality kindergarten with our long day care to help prepare them for their upcoming transitions into formal schooling. Each room in our centre is led by an early childhood Teacher.

Our three-year-old curriculum emphasises developing some of the social, emotional and communication skills that the children will use as they gain more independence. We encourage development in these areas through group play and some slightly more structured activities.

For four-year-olds, the corriculum focuses on further developing their communication, social and emotional skills, and they also begin exploring some numbers, shapes, phonics, science concepts, and all sorts of new ideas. Guided by an early childhood Teacher, we aim to equip each child for a life of learning.
